Let's look at what tanks got in this expansion:
Paladin Gained:
1. Gets to block magic, can refill its gauge quickly getting a self shield that works really well on tank busters and mitigates only 4% less than Dark Knights strongest skill.
2. Gained the ability to have uninterruptible casting, as well as had all of its mana costs cut in half.
3. Cover buffed to mitigate damage and cover magical damage
4. Party shield
5. New powerful magic attack.
6. oGCD skill which buffs its hard hitting magical attacks/increases its self healing if you choose to. Buffed by its physical cooldown
7. Several potency buffs to its dps combo.
8. The ability to share your mitigation with your cotank
Lost:
1. Made several contributions to the new CR system, has room to slot everything back.
2. Halone combo debuff removed
3. Foresight
4. Bloodbath
Warrior Gained:
1. Gained an oGCD gap closer on half the cooldown and 33% longer range than the dark knight equivalent. Used in dps rotation as a guage dump, generates enmity.
2. Gained a resource cut allowing it to double the number of its hardest hitting moves, accessible every other burst window, prevents many negative effects which could work against it (push backs, stuns, and binds, and sleep).
3. Gained a powerful oGCD attack which ignores its tank stance penalty and is buffed by its tank stance, a defensive cooldown, and its offensive cooldown.
4. Gained a party wide shield on a short cooldown
5. Potency buffs and guage buffs to its dps combo
6. Selfsustain buffs to moves in tank stance
7. Removed the requirement of needing to burn its mitigation in order to fuel burst phase.
8. Gained access to Rampart, a better alternative to its native cooldown
Lost:
1. oGCD Stun
2. Raid wide mitigation
3. Low potency Dot removed
4. Lost foresight, but gained rampart
5. RIP Bloodbath
6. Mercy Stroke
7. Lost access to second wind through CR system
8. Internal release (crit version)
Dark Knight Gained:
1. Gained Delirium buffing resource generating abilities, is 1/4 the potency of the warrior and paladin equivalents.
2. Gained an AOE move which helps restore mana
3. Gained a single target hard hitting move.
4. Gained a shield which can be used frequently but can be risky to use as frequently as is available.
5. Resource generating abilities buffed to generate the new resource.
6. Potency of dps combo raised, blood generation added to dps combo ender
Lost:
1. oGCD stun, the potency of the stun, and the proc mechanic reseting the stun
2. Lost a fluff cooldown in dark dance
3. Lost Reprisal, 250 potency with a damage down debuff
4. Lost access to foresight as a cooldown through CR system
5. Dark Passenger potency cuts to oblivion
6. Unleash potency cuts
7. Contributions to the CR system cannot all be slotted back without giving up necessary tank moves.
8. Selfsustained lowered
9. Lost a high potency dot
10. Lost access to Mercy Stroke through CR system
11. Magical debuff from DPS combo removed (RIP 3.x Delirium)

So lets go from here then. Back in 3.x PLD was trash for Alex as almost all tank busters/autos were Magic. Twist this around for 3.x... imagine if all the tank busters were now physical with little-no need for magic defensives. Guess who would have gotten the 4.x buff instead.
All in all, when people stop bringing a job to savage all together the team investigates. Currently in every savage fight I've seen on fflogs so far... PLD/WAR is overtaking DRK in terms of usage & popularity. What Yoshida is implying is that "Well players must not understand how beneficial TBN is, it's less visibly apparently than Shake It Off". This statement is just straight wrong, it's an Apples - Oranges comparison.
TBN is a single target 20%(self) or 10%(another person) hp shield that costs a hefty amount of personal resources on a 15 second cooldown
Shake It Off costs nothing, shields the whole group up to 24% (most people only use the base 8% since its free) at the cost of all your personal defensives if going for the 24%. HOWEVER it costs nothing if you only need the base 8%... which is only 2% less than TBN and has a 90 second cooldown.
TL;DR - What does a DRK bring that a WAR or a PLD can't? The answer is nothing, so people won't bring it. With people not bringing it, it will lead to more exposure by the dev team.
